Panopsis is a genus of evergreen trees belonging to the Proteaceae family. These plants naturally occur in the tropical forests of Central and South America, preferring humid and warm climatic zones with consistently high annual temperatures.

For successful growth and development, this crop requires well-drained, fertile soils with an acidic to neutral pH. The plant does not tolerate waterlogging at the roots, so areas with heavy clay soils without prior land improvement are unsuitable for commercial cultivation.

Biologically, Panopsis is adapted to the tropical belt where there is no distinct seasonal variation with low temperatures. The optimal temperature range for vegetation is between 22 and 30 degrees Celsius, and the plant requires protection from direct cold winds.

An important aspect is providing sufficient lighting, although young seedlings may require shade during their first years of life. Under tropical conditions, the crop shows high metabolic intensity, allowing the tree to quickly accumulate biomass if rainfall is sufficient.

The economic use of Panopsis is focused primarily on the harvesting of fruits, which are valued in local cuisine as a source of nutrients. Furthermore, the wood of certain species is used in carpentry due to its strength and distinct grain texture.

In its natural habitat and under cultivation, Panopsis can be exposed to specific tropical pathogens, including fungal diseases of the root system. Root rots are the most dangerous, as they spread rapidly in conditions of excessive soil moisture.

The leaf foliage is often attacked by powdery mildew and various types of rust, which negatively affect the photosynthesis process. To control these pathogens, it is necessary to maintain proper spacing between plantings to ensure better air circulation within the tree canopies.

Among the pests, xylophagous insects and various species of aphids that suck sap from young shoots pose the greatest threat. These insects not only weaken the plant but often act as vectors for viral diseases that affect the tree's vascular system.

Preventive measures include regular monitoring of the planting condition and sanitary pruning of affected branches. The use of biological pest control methods is preferred to maintain the ecological balance within the plantations.

A key requirement of agrotechnics is maintaining an optimal level of mineral nutrition, as a deficiency in micronutrients makes the tree more susceptible to infections. Regular fertilization strengthens the immunity of Panopsis and contributes to its increased resistance to adverse environmental factors.
